本文目录导读:
关系型数据库是当今世界最广泛使用的一种数据库类型,其基本结构经过多年的发展,已经形成了四种常见的分类,本文将详细介绍这四种分类,并对其应用进行解析。
四种关系型数据库基本结构分类
1、集合模型
图片来源于网络,如有侵权联系删除
集合模型是关系型数据库的基本结构,由一组元组组成,每个元组代表一个实体,而元组中的每个元素代表实体的一个属性,集合模型具有以下特点:
(1)每个元组是唯一的,即不存在重复的元组。
(2)属性值的顺序可以任意改变,不影响数据的存储和查询。
(3)每个属性只能有一个值,即每个属性只能有一个域。
(4)属性之间没有顺序关系。
集合模型是最基本的关系型数据库结构,适用于简单的数据存储和查询。
2、层次模型
层次模型以树状结构表示实体及其之间关系,在层次模型中,每个节点代表一个实体,节点之间的连线表示实体之间的关系,层次模型具有以下特点:
(1)每个节点只有一个父节点,称为根节点。
(2)每个节点可以有多个子节点。
(3)节点之间的关系是“一对多”的关系。
图片来源于网络,如有侵权联系删除
层次模型适用于表示具有明显层次关系的数据,如组织结构、家族关系等。
3、网状模型
网状模型是一种以网状结构表示实体及其之间关系的数据库模型,在网状模型中,每个节点可以与多个节点相连,形成一个复杂的网状结构,网状模型具有以下特点:
(1)每个节点可以有多个父节点。
(2)节点之间的关系是“多对多”的关系。
(3)网状模型可以表示复杂的实体关系。
网状模型适用于表示具有复杂关系的实体,如社交网络、供应链等。
4、关系模型
关系模型是目前最流行的一种数据库模型,它将实体和实体之间的关系表示为二维表格,在关系模型中,每个表格称为一个关系,表格中的行称为元组,列称为属性,关系模型具有以下特点:
(1)每个关系都是唯一的。
(2)每个属性都有一个明确的名称。
图片来源于网络,如有侵权联系删除
(3)每个属性都有一个明确的域。
(4)关系中的元组顺序可以任意改变。
关系模型是目前应用最广泛的关系型数据库模型,如MySQL、Oracle、SQL Server等。
四种关系型数据库基本结构的应用解析
1、集合模型:适用于简单的数据存储和查询,如个人简历、库存管理等。
2、层次模型:适用于表示具有明显层次关系的数据,如组织结构、家族关系等。
3、网状模型:适用于表示具有复杂关系的实体,如社交网络、供应链等。
4、关系模型:适用于各种复杂的数据存储和查询,如企业资源计划(ERP)、客户关系管理(CRM)等。
关系型数据库的基本结构经过多年的发展,已经形成了四种常见的分类:集合模型、层次模型、网状模型和关系模型,每种模型都有其特点和适用场景,在实际应用中,应根据具体需求选择合适的数据库模型,随着数据库技术的不断发展,未来还将出现更多新型的数据库模型,以满足不同领域的需求。
标签: #关系型数据库的结构常见的分类为哪四种
评论列表